rabbitmountain
Offline
• • • •
Upload & Sell: Off
p.4 #7 · p.4 #7 · $4,000 budget - what would you get?


I personally recommended a 5D3 IIRC. That would be my minimum level body for $4k. I suppose the value of glass depends on individual preference. I shot my good old 5D2 and 5Dc for real and paid assignments within a year ago. I used 70-200/2.8ii, 35L and 85L glass, which I could not have used if I had spent my money on two newer bodies, e.g. A pair of new 5D3s. The IQ coming out of those lenses is stunning even if shot on a 5Dc. This is my personal preference. If you take better pictures with a lower grade lens and a higher grade camera like a 5D3 then by all means get that because the final result is what matters.

Zeiss Milvus 100mm f/2 macro/portrait lens ($1843)
Canon 24-70mm f/4 IS $899
B+W 77mm polariser for the zoom $108
~$1100 for a used 1Ds Mk III and spare battery

This is approximately the core of the system I already have (with the weather-sealed Milvus instead of the older chrome-ring Zeiss 100mm f/2 I do have - so that now the whole kit is weather sealed). I can shoot most of my landscape and botanical subjects with this. Not being able to get out to 200mm is a loss for architecture, and of course there's no wildlife capability and no flash.

At other times I think a 16-35 would be better than the 24-70. You can't do both in the budget (and I don't like used lenses at all).
